Pacifier Teeth: How Prolonged Use Harms Your Child’s Jaw & Dental Health

Pacifiers can be a lifesaver for parents, soothing fussy babies and helping them sleep. However, prolonged use—especially beyond ages 2–3—can have lasting effects on a child’s dental and jaw development. Understanding these risks, knowing when to wean off pacifiers, and recognizing corrective measures can help parents make informed decisions.

The Domino Effect: How a Single Missing Tooth Throws Your Entire Smile Out of Alignment

We’ve all heard the saying, "like pulling teeth" to describe something difficult. But what happens when a tooth is lost naturally? It’s often dismissed as a minor issue, especially if it’s a back tooth not visible when you smile. However, dentistry and medical research reveal a very different, more concerning reality. Your mouth functions as a precise, interconnected system where every tooth plays a vital role in supporting the delicate balance of chewing, speech, and jaw health.

Discover the Healing Potential Inside Your Wisdom Teeth

Wisdom teeth are often seen as problematic molars that need to be extracted due to pain, infection, or misalignment. However, recent scientific discoveries have revealed something truly remarkable — wisdom teeth contain stem cells, powerful biological tools that can regenerate and repair human tissue.
